Safety first, bounce second. Before considering any jumper, remember that proper construction is non-negotiable. Look for stable bases, appropriate weight limits, and enclosed designs that prevent falls. The American Academy of Pediatrics recommends checking for ASTM certification—a signal that the product meets rigorous safety standards.

Fisher-Price Animal Wonders Jumperoo: The Sensory Powerhouse

The Fisher-Price Animal Wonders Jumperoo stands as a testament to thoughtful design in the children’s activity space. This jungle-themed sensation transforms ordinary jumping into an immersive safari adventure.

Key Features:

  • 360-degree rotating seat allowing complete access to toys
  • Height-adjustable frame with 3 settings to accommodate growing toddlers
  • Self-contained spring mechanism with protective covers for tiny fingers
  • Machine-washable seat pad for inevitable messes

What truly sets the Animal Wonders Jumperoo apart is its developmental approach. Each activity station targets specific skills—from fine motor coordination to cause-and-effect learning. The strategically placed piano keys reward jumping with musical notes, creating an intuitive connection between movement and sound that delights toddlers while teaching fundamental concepts.

Baby Einstein Neptune’s Ocean Discovery Jumper: Developmental Wonderland

The Baby Einstein Neptune’s Ocean Discovery Jumper transforms playtime into an underwater learning expedition that captivates curious minds.

Standout Elements:

  • Electronic sea turtle station with lights, classical melodies, and language exposure in English, Spanish, and French
  • 360-degree seat rotation encouraging full-body movement
  • 5 height positions accommodating growing toddlers
  • Removable toy stations for floor play versatility

This ocean-themed marvel excels in cognitive development through its thoughtfully designed activity stations. The electronic sea turtle introduces numbers, colors, and multiple languages—creating early exposure to essential concepts. Parents consistently report that the Neptune’s Ocean Discovery maintains engagement longer than competitors, with the removable toys extending play value beyond the jumping stage.

Skip Hop Explore & More Jumpscape Fold-Away Jumper: The Space-Saving Champion

For families navigating limited space, the Skip Hop Explore & More Jumpscape delivers premium features without the permanent footprint.

Portability Advantages:

  • Innovative fold-flat design requiring 50% less storage space
  • Lightweight frame (14.3 lbs) with built-in carry handle
  • Tool-free assembly in under 3 minutes
  • Machine-washable seat pad and removable toy elements
Feature Storage Footprint Setup Time Weight
Jumpscape 6″ when folded 3 minutes 14.3 lbs
Typical Jumper 24″+ diameter 15+ minutes 18-25 lbs

The Jumpscape’s brilliance lies in its growth accommodation. The elastic bounce cords provide three tension settings, allowing you to adjust resistance as your child develops. This thoughtful design extends the usable lifespan significantly compared to fixed-tension competitors, making it an exceptional value despite its premium price point.

Price vs. Value: The Real Cost Analysis

The jumper market spans from budget-friendly options to premium powerhouses, but the sticker price rarely tells the whole story.

The Fisher-Price Animal Wonders Jumperoo sits comfortably in the mid-range at $89.99, delivering impressive bang-for-buck with its 360-degree rotating seat and 12+ activity stations. Parents consistently report 8+ months of regular use before children outgrow it—bringing the cost-per-bounce to pennies.

At the premium end, the Skip Hop Explore & More commands $129.99 but includes convertible features that transform from jumper to activity table, extending usability well into year three. The extended lifespan justifies the higher initial investment for families planning multiple children.

Budget-conscious shoppers gravitate toward the Bright Starts Bounce ’n Spring at $59.99. While it lacks the bells and whistles of premium models, its core jumping function remains solid, making it the efficiency champion for families watching their dollars.

Jumper Model Price Cost Per Month (6-month use) Cost Per Month (12-month use)
Fisher-Price Jumperoo $89.99 $15.00 $7.50
Skip Hop Explore & More $129.99 $21.67 $10.83
Bright Starts Bounce ’n Spring $59.99 $10.00 $5.00

Durability and Maintenance Showdown

The maintenance equation factors heavily into the true value calculation. The Fisher-Price Jumperoo features machine-washable seat pads and wipe-clean plastic components, requiring approximately 20 minutes of monthly maintenance.

The Skip Hop’s fabric elements require more delicate handling, with spot-cleaning recommended for most spills. However, its sturdier frame construction has proven remarkably resilient in high-traffic households, with springs showing minimal wear even after 18+ months of enthusiastic jumping.

Bright Starts offers surprisingly robust construction despite its lower price point. The simplified design means fewer potential failure points, though the seat fabric tends to show wear faster than its competitors. Replacement parts availability becomes crucial in the durability equation—both Fisher-Price and Skip Hop maintain excellent spare parts programs, while Bright Starts lags slightly in this department.

Matching Jumpers to Your Home and Child

Your perfect jumper match depends on three critical factors: space constraints, your child’s temperament, and developmental goals.

For compact living spaces, the Bright Starts model offers the smallest footprint at 27 inches in diameter. The Fisher-Price Jumperoo requires approximately 36 inches of clearance, while the Skip Hop demands a generous 40-inch diameter but folds for storage.

Active explorers who crave stimulation thrive with the Fisher-Price’s sensory-rich environment. Children who easily overstimulate may prefer the more streamlined Bright Starts design. Meanwhile, the Skip Hop strikes a thoughtful balance with adjustable toy positioning that grows with your child’s interests.

For homes with hardwood floors, the Skip Hop’s non-slip feet provide superior stability. Carpet-dwellers find the wider base of the Fisher-Price prevents tipping during enthusiastic bouncing sessions.

The verdict? The Fisher-Price Jumperoo delivers the best overall value for most families, the Skip Hop justifies its premium for space-conscious homes seeking longevity, and the Bright Starts remains the budget champion without significant compromise on the core jumping experience.
